What is a Mattress Protector? The Basics Explained
A mattress protector is essentially a fitted cover that encases either the top surface or the entire mattress. Unlike regular sheets or mattress pads, protectors are specifically designed to guard against various threats to your mattress's condition and longevity. Here's what makes them special:
- Waterproof Barrier: Creates an impenetrable shield against liquids while remaining breathable
- Allergen Protection: Blocks dust mites, pollen, and other common allergens
- Temperature Regulation: Many modern protectors include cooling properties
- Bed Bug Prevention: Acts as a barrier against these persistent pests
- Warranty Protection: Helps maintain warranty validity by preventing damage

Mattress Care Tips: How a Protector Simplifies Cleaning
Keeping your mattress clean becomes significantly easier with a mattress protector. I want to share some practical tips and compare different cleaning scenarios to show you just how much time and effort a protector can save you.
Cleaning Task | With Mattress Protector | Without Mattress Protector |
Liquid Spills | Remove protector, machine wash | Deep cleaning required, possible staining |
Dust Management | Regular protector washing | Vacuum frequently, deep cleaning needed |
Allergen Control | Monthly protector washing | Professional cleaning recommended |
General Maintenance | Quick wipe-down as needed | Regular professional cleaning |
Regular maintenance with a mattress protector is straightforward and effective. Here's what I recommend for optimal care:
- Wash your mattress protector every 1-2 months in warm water
- Spot clean any spills immediately to prevent seepage
- Use gentle detergents to maintain the protector's waterproof properties
- Air dry when possible, or use low heat settings
- Keep a spare protector for immediate replacement during washing
Following these simple steps can help maintain a clean and healthy sleep environment with minimal effort. The beauty of using a mattress protector is that it takes the complexity out of mattress maintenance, turning what could be a challenging task into a manageable routine.
Choosing an Easy-to-Clean Mattress Protector for Hassle-Free Use
When selecting a mattress protector that's easy to clean, there are several key features to consider. First, look for protectors made with machine-washable materials. This might seem obvious, but not all protectors are created equal in terms of washing durability. I always recommend checking the care instructions before purchasing. The best mattress protectors can handle regular washing without losing their protective qualities. Look for options that can withstand warm water washing, as this helps ensure better cleaning of allergens and bacteria. Material quality plays a huge role in ease of cleaning. Quality protectors often feature:
- Smooth surfaces that resist staining
- Quick-drying fabrics that prevent mildew
- Sturdy seams that won't break down in the wash
- Breathable materials that reduce odor retention
- Strong elastic edges that maintain their shape after washing
Consider the size and weight of the protector as well. Bulky protectors can be difficult to manage in home washing machines. A lightweight yet effective protector is often the best choice for easy maintenance. The way a protector fits your mattress also affects how easy it is to clean. Look for designs with deep pockets and strong elastic that stays in place. This prevents bunching and shifting, which can make removal and replacement much simpler. For maximum convenience, some people choose to have two protectors in rotation. This setup allows you to immediately make your bed with a clean protector while washing the other one, ensuring continuous protection without any gaps in coverage. Remember, a truly easy-to-clean mattress protector should fit your lifestyle. If you have kids or pets, you might want something that can handle frequent washing. If you're mainly concerned about occasional spills, a lighter-duty option might work fine.

How to Choose a Mattress Protector that Meets Your Needs
Selecting the right mattress protector starts with understanding your specific needs. Do you have young children or pets? You'll want maximum waterproof protection. Do you sleep hot? Look for options with cooling properties. Are you sensitive to allergens? Focus on protectors with specialized barrier technologies.
I recommend measuring your mattress before purchasing, including the depth, to ensure a proper fit. Many modern mattresses are quite thick, so standard-sized protectors might not provide adequate coverage. Check the product specifications carefully, and when in doubt, choose a protector with deeper pockets.
Consider your sleeping habits and lifestyle when making your selection. If you're prone to night sweats, prioritize breathability. If you have allergies, look for certified hypoallergenic options. The right choice will depend on your individual circumstances and sleep preferences.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
How often should I wash my mattress protector? I recommend washing your mattress protector every 1-2 months, or immediately after any spills. Regular washing helps maintain its protective properties and keeps your sleep environment fresh.
Will a mattress protector make my bed feel different? A high-quality mattress protector is designed to be virtually unnoticeable. You'll still feel the comfort of your mattress while getting the protection you need.
Can I put a mattress protector over a mattress topper? Yes, you can use a mattress protector over both your mattress and mattress topper. Just make sure to get the right size to accommodate the extra height.
Do mattress protectors really help with allergies? Yes, hypoallergenic mattress protectors create a barrier against common allergens like dust mites, pet dander, and pollen, helping reduce allergy symptoms.
Are all mattress protectors waterproof? No, not all protectors are waterproof. While many offer water resistance, it's important to check the specific features when buying one.
How long do mattress protectors last? With proper care, a quality mattress protector should last 1-2 years. Replace it sooner if you notice any tears or diminished effectiveness.
Will a mattress protector void my mattress warranty? No, using a mattress protector actually helps maintain your warranty by preventing the kind of damage that might void it.
Can bed bugs get through a mattress protector? Quality mattress protectors create a barrier that bed bugs can't penetrate, helping prevent infestations.
Do I need a mattress protector for a new mattress? Yes, using a protector from day one is the best way to keep your new mattress in pristine condition.
Are mattress protectors hot to sleep on? Modern mattress protectors are designed with breathable materials that shouldn't affect your sleep temperature.
Can I put a mattress protector in the dryer? Most mattress protectors are dryer-safe on low heat. Always check the care label for specific instructions.
Do I need a special protector for a memory foam mattress? While any quality protector will work, look for one that's breathable to maintain the benefits of your memory foam mattress.
Should I buy multiple mattress protectors? Having a spare protector is helpful for continuous protection while one is being washed.
Can I use a mattress protector on an adjustable bed? Yes, just make sure to choose a protector that's designed to work with adjustable bases.
Is a mattress pad the same as a mattress protector? No, mattress pads add cushioning while protectors focus on protecting against spills and allergens. Some people use both.
